Hi — quick handover on the secure interview room (Room 4B, behind the Ferngate Labs library). New starters: this is where all candidate interviews happen, so keep it tidy and never leave notes or laptops behind. The whiteboard must be wiped after every session — yes, every time. Book it through the Roomly board by the kitchen, not by sticking a note on the door like some people do. The door lock was rekeyed last week, so your old code won't work. Use the new pass code below.

turnstile pass: bdg-YPPQB-52010

Handover — Regional Sales Review. Incoming director: the Westmoor region review is half done. Q1 numbers weak in three of seven territories; Hollis Verany is pulling the variance analysis. Pipeline data in the shared tracker is current to last Friday. Two territory managers are on improvement plans — handle with care. Final review presentation due to the executive committee in four weeks. Confidential plans are set out below.

management briefing: Project Ulavan slips by two quarters because of the staffing delay.

Visitors to the Kestrel prototype workshop at Dunmore Works must be pre-registered and accompanied at all times. Reception should issue a red lanyard, confirm photo ID, and log entry and exit times. Photography is not permitted inside the workshop. If the escorting engineer is delayed, visitors wait in the atrium. The workshop door code for escorts is below.

staff pass of kahop-kadup = bdg-NCCCQ-99141